متن کاملOn the 2-Stage Stochastic-Weighted Matching Problem
We study a 2-stage stochastic extension of the classical maximum weighted matching problem on graphs, proposed recently by Kong and Schaefer [2004]. The authors show the NPhardness of the problem and present a constant factor approximation algorithm. This work explores an extension of this approximation algorithm and studies its computational performance.
